Flooring Replacement After Water Damage v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 10 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small water leaks, but be sure to dry the area thoroughly and check for any signs of further damage. |
| Visible water damage (more than 10 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Visible water dam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ough drying process. |
| Water damage to subfloor or joists | No | Yes | Water damage to subfloor or joists needs professional attention to ensure the structural integrity of your home.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| Musty odors or mold growth need professional attention to remove and prevent further growth.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| Warped or buckled flooring needs professional attention to repair or replace the affected area. |
| Discoloration or fading | No | Yes | Discoloration or fading can be a sign of water damage and needs professional attention to identify and fix the source. |
While DIY may be enough for small water leaks, visible water damage, water damage to subfloor or joists, musty odors or mold growth, warped or buckled flooring, and discoloration or fading need profess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ough drying process.
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ost In Youngsville, NC
The cost of flooring replacement after water damage can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Youngsville, NC. These are estimates, not guarantees.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your specific project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Flooring replacement (carpet)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, labor costs |
| Flooring replacement (hardwood) |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, labor costs |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of mold growth |
| Disinfecting and dehumidifying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Final inspection and tou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
